LGBTQ+ Issues therapists in Santa Fe, New Mexico Statistics

LGBTQ+ Issues therapists in Santa Fe, New Mexico average 12 years of experience and charge around $200 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(44%), Internal Family Systems (IFS) (44%), and Somatic Therapy (44%).
